Richard Gorman is 65 years old and about to retire. He has ​$784,000 saved to supplement his pension and Social Security and would like to withdraw it in equal annual dollar amounts so that nothing is left after 14 years. How much does he have to withdraw each year if he earns 5 percent on his​ money?
